Course Content

• Autonomous Driving Fundamentals in Sports Applications
• Perception Systems for Autonomous Sports Vehicles: Sensor Fusion and Object Recognition
• Motion Planning and Control for Dynamic Sports Environments
• Autonomous Vehicle Software Architecture for Sports: ROS and Simulation
• Safety and Regulations for Autonomous Sports Vehicles
• Machine Learning for Autonomous Sports: Training and Deployment
• Human-Robot Interaction in Autonomous Sports
• Case Studies: Autonomous Vehicles in Motorsports and Extreme Sports
